After flying high against St. Lucy's last Monday, Rancho Cucamonga came back down to earth. The Rancho Cucamonga Cougars lost 3-0 to the Upland Highlanders/Scots on Wednesday. The Cougars were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Highlanders/Scots ap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in September.
The match finished with set scores of 25-18, 25-10, 25-18.
Leading Upland to victory were Addison Contreras and Sydney Ryan. Contreras had 19 digs, while Ryan had eight digs and two aces. Contreras has been hot recently, having posted 11 or more digs the last six times she's played.
Rancho Cucamonga now has a losing record at 15-16. As for Upland, the win was the fourth in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 16-5.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. After both having extra time off, Rancho Cucamonga and Los Osos will dust off their jerseys to face off against one another at 4:45 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Upland, they will head out on the road to square off against St. Lucy's at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. St. Lucy's is coming into the game with five straight defeats at home, meaning Upland will have to defend against a team hungry for a victory.
